Job Description
A VFX heavy show is looking for an experienced Project Manager.
Project Manager responsibilities:
* Working closely with VFX Supervisor and Producer during development and pre-production, all the way to post.
* Act as a central point of contact between the VFX Supervisor and Producer and the VFX internal team, as well as between the departments within the projects.
* In collaboration with the VFX Supervisor and Producer, establish a production plan and schedule for the multiple shows and ensure prioritization of resources.
* Keeping track of the planned schedules and milestones and communicating any changes
* Assign daily work tasks to VFX coordinators and VFX editors, track progress of the project using Shotgun, and ensure work is running smoothly and that it is meeting with the Supervisors and Producer requests.
* Manage VFX vendors, track their progress and make sure deadlines are met in a timely manner.
Qualifications :
* 3+ years of VFX experience required, specifically as a project manager
* Must be able to work independently and communicate effectively and can think fast and make decisions
* Attention to detail and constantly looking for ways to improve operational efficiencies within the project.
* Ability to prioritize and work under pressure
* Proficient user of Shotgun and Microsoft Excel.
* High level of organization and follow-through skills, while remaining flexible
* Natural team worker.
The role:
The applicant should be well established in the VFX industry with 3-5 years experience as a VFX Project Manager. A strong understanding of VFX workflow and scheduling is required. You must excel at managing multiple projects in a high-speed, high-performance environment.
